Books Included in This Collection:
Fear in the Cotswolds
In a wintry, isolated house-sitting assignment, Thea confronts a chilling blend of loneliness and lurking trouble. As storms lash the hedgerows and routines falter, the line between hospitality and hazard blurs. Thea’s practical instincts and quiet empathy guide her as she pieces together clues that a seemingly peaceful retreat masks more than one secret. This opener establishes the comforting pace and sharp deductive focus that define the series, inviting new readers to fall for Thea’s world while rewarding longtime fans with familiar, satisfying motifs.
Deception in the Cotswolds
A summer stay for a transatlantic reptile breeder becomes a test of trust, as the outward calm of village life conceals tension and hidden agendas. Thea must navigate delicate social dynamics, assess risk, and decide whom to trust when rumors mingle with real danger. The result is a brisk, engaging puzzle that balances human drama with the gentle charm of the Cotswolds, expanding Thea’s cast of intriguing neighbours and reinforcing the series’ reputation for clever misdirection and humane psychology.

About the Author:
Rebecca Tope is a celebrated British crime novelist renowned for her character-rich, setting-driven mysteries. She created the Thea Osborne house-sitting series in the English countryside, which blends traditional detection with warm, human storytelling. Tope’s work is favored by readers who relish a comforting yet cunning puzzle wrapped in evocative landscapes, small-town dynamics, and practical, down-to-earth protagonists. Her books are distinguished by their steady pacing, clever misdirection, and enduring appeal to fans of classic English crime fiction.
